The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) has granted exceptions under certain Medicare quality reporting, value-based purchasing and payment programs to providers located in Butte, Los Angeles and Ventura counties, which have all been designated by the Federal Emergency Management Agency as major disaster areas (DR-4407) due to the impact of the California wildfires.

Providers in those counties will be granted an exception and are not required to submit a request. 

A summary of the exceptions is listed below. More detailed information is included in a CMS memo.

Post-Acute Care Providers

  • All quality reporting program (QRP) reporting requirements, including the reporting of data on measures and any other data requested by CMS for the post-acute care QRPs

Inpatient Hospitals

  • Reporting requirements under the Hospital Consumer Assessment of Healthcare Providers and Systems Survey (HCAHPS)
  • Influenza Vaccination Coverage Among Healthcare Personnel measure
  • All Hospital Inpatient Quality Reporting Program chart-abstracted measures, including clinical population and sampling data and National Healthcare Safety Network (NHSN) Healthcare-Associated Infection (HAI) measures
  • Clinical Data Abstraction Center (CDAC) records for chart-abstracted measures and HAI validation templates

Outpatient Hospitals

  • Submission deadline for all Hospital Outpatient QRP chart-abstracted measures
  • CDAC records for chart-abstracted measures

Ambulatory Surgical Centers

  • Data collection and submission requirements for all measures during the annual submission period for 2018 for the Ambulatory Surgical Center QRP

MIPS-Eligible Clinicians

  • MIPS-eligible clinicians will be automatically identified, and no action is required.
  • MIPS-eligible clinicians who are subject to the Alternative Payment Model scoring standard are not covered by the automatic extreme and uncontrollable circumstance policy, but may apply for an exception in the Promoting Interoperability performance category.

PPS-Exempt Cancer Hospitals

  • Chart-abstracted data and NHSN HAI data
  • HCAHPS reporting requirements
  • Influenza Vaccination Coverage Among Healthcare Personnel measure
